 |Isn’t it because it is simply the control code + 0100 to arrive at the
 |capitals column of the ascii table? (http://www.asciitable.com)
 |
 |Hence ^@ for NULL and ^[ for ESC.

That is also what i thought and think.  The MUA i maintain now
documents (in the next release):

  ‘\cX’    A mechanism that allows usage of the non-printable
           (ASCII and compatible) control codes 0 to 31: to cre‐
           ate the printable representation of a control code the
           numeric value 64 is added, and the resulting ASCII
           character set code point is then printed, e.g., BEL is
           ‘7 + 64 = 71 = G’.  Whereas historically circumflex
           notation has often been used for visualization pur‐
           poses of control codes, e.g., ‘^G’, the reverse
           solidus notation has been standardized: ‘\cG’.  Some
           control codes also have standardized (ISO 10646, ISO
           C) alias representations, as shown above (e.g., ‘\a’,
           ‘\n’, ‘\t’): whenever such an alias exists S-nail will
           use it for display purposes.  The control code NUL
           (‘\c@’) ends argument processing without producing
           further output.
